May First in Pictures

This rather handy diagram came from Politics Home and was published before the May first elections as a way to gauge the relative success or failure of the three main parties:









In order to read it accurately you have to remember that the Conservatives gained 256 Councillors, Labour lost 331 and the Liberal Democrats gained 34.

Updated: The latest numbers are Conservatives gained 300 and Labour lost 434(!). Given these seats were last fought at the height of the Iraq debacle then this is extraordinary. The language in the Sundays will be interesting.
